Bright Minds Biosciences Participates in Key Scientific Conferences

Bright Minds Biosciences Inc. (CSE: DRUG), a trailblazer in developing selective 5-HT2 agonists, is gearing up for exciting scientific exchanges in the near future. The company is set to showcase its innovative work, focusing on treating drug-resistant epilepsy, depression, and other neurological disorders.

Upcoming Conference Engagements

This biotech firm is scheduled to present its groundbreaking research at several premier scientific conferences:

Neuroscience Annual Meeting

The Neuroscience 2024 meeting, organized by the Society for Neuroscience, will bring together leading experts from October 5–9 in Chicago. Bright Minds will highlight their advancements and novel therapies aimed at addressing critical issues in neurological conditions.

Collaborative Efforts

During the Therapeutic Development event at NINDS on October 7, Bright Minds will discuss their collaborative projects with NIH, focusing on their epilepsy (ETSP) and pain (PSPP) programs. This partnership underscores their commitment to advancing research that bridges clinical and preclinical findings.

BIO-Europe and Chicago Biocapital Summit

In November, Bright Minds will attend BIO-Europe, Europe’s leading partnering event, in Stockholm. This presents a valuable opportunity for networking and fostering relationships with key players in the biotechnology sector. Following this, they will showcase the latest in Midwest biotech at the Chicago Biocapital Summit from November 6-7.

AES Annual Meeting 2024

At the AES Annual Meeting from December 6-10 in Los Angeles, the company will present the efficacy data for BMB-101, their lead compound aimed at treating rare forms of epilepsy. Company Developments: Option Grants

In an exciting move to align interests between the company's success and that of its team, Bright Minds has granted 70,000 options to employees and board members. These options are part of their share option plan, with an exercise price of $1.65 per share, valid for five years. Highlight on BMB-101

BMB-101 stands out as a promising novel compound specifically designed to tackle chronic neurological disorders. Its unique action as a Gq-protein biased agonist targets the 5-HT2C receptor, a feature that could mitigate the risk of tolerance often affiliated with traditional treatments. The innovative mechanism highlights its potential as a new anti-epileptic drug, ensuring sustained relief for patients who experience difficult-to-manage seizures.

In Phase 1 clinical trials, BMB-101 was administered to 64 healthy volunteers, establishing its safety and tolerability across all doses tested. Remarkably, no severe adverse events were reported, showcasing its profile as a viable candidate for further development.
